    <fulldesc>&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;New Delhi, Nov 21 (KNN)&lt;/strong&gt; The holders of current / overdraft / cash credit accounts, which are operational for the last three months or more, can now withdraw upto Rs 50000 in cash, in a week, RBI has said.&lt;/p&gt;&#13;
&#13;
&lt;p&gt;Earlier RBI had given this relief just to the current account holders (applicable to Current Accounts which are operational for last three months or more).&lt;/p&gt;&#13;
&#13;
&lt;p&gt;They were allowed to withdraw up to Rs 50000 in cash, in a week.&lt;/p&gt;&#13;
&#13;
&lt;p&gt;On a review, it has been decided to extend this facility to Overdraft and Cash Credit accounts also. Accordingly, holders of current / overdraft / cash credit accounts, which are operational for the last three months or more, may now withdraw upto Rs 50000 in cash, in a week, RBI has said in a notification.&lt;/p&gt;&#13;
&#13;
&lt;p&gt;However, RBI has clarified that this enhanced limit for weekly withdrawal is not applicable for personal overdraft accounts.&lt;/p&gt;&#13;
&#13;
&lt;p&gt;Also the apex bank said such withdrawals may be disbursed predominantly in Rs 2000 denomination bank notes. &lt;strong&gt;(KNN Bureau)&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&#13;
